The discovery of the presumed parasite in the human remains is past extrapolated to the present relationship between the host and the parasiteChagas indisposition or American trypanosomiasis is caused by Trypanosoma cruzi. The reference exists in wild amongst various animal species constituting the sylvatic cycle (Afuderheide et al., 2004). The vector for its transmission is reduviid bug (family Reduviidae, subfamily Triatominae). These insects pass over in the crevices, nests or human dwellings in case of domestic cycle and emerge at shadow to feed upon the blood of their prey (Afuderheide et al., 2004). The infection is caused by rubbing of the bitten area where the parasite deposits the faecal proposition (Afuderheide et al., 2004). This leads to entry of the parasite into the blood stream from the breached skin or conjunctiva. Parasitemia may lead to astute man ifestations of myocarditis or meningoencephalitis that have a mortality rate of 10% (Afuderheide et al., 2004). Origin of samples Atacama Desert with its dry hot winds and arid climate has been a arising of mummified tissues for many researchers (Ferreira et al., 2000 Afuderheide et al., 2004 Guhl et al., 2000). This type of climate favours the preservation of body tissues in a dehydrated form and well arrests its decomposition. Moreover, this geographical region coincides with the distribution of the disease, along coastal region of entropy America in Peru and Chile. South American natives buried their dead in shallow sandy soils that led to preservation of tissues in a desiccated mummified form Laboratory techniques This desiccated tissue is rehydrated and pulverised and DNA is extracted. The extracted DNA is then amplified utilise the Polymerase chain reaction. The amplified DNA participates in the hybridization process with standardised primers and probes under controlled conditions. Hybridisation of the DNA extracted from the mummified tissue samples with the probe nucleotides consti tutes a positive test result.
